Download jetbrains nodejs ide8/27/2023 ![]() Select the required Node.js installation from the Node Interpreter list. Press Ctrl+Alt+S to open the IDE settings and select Languages & Frameworks | Node.js. With WebStorm, you can have several installations of Node.js and switch between them while working on the same project. Make sure the JavaScript and TypeScript and Node.js required plugins are enabled on the Settings | Plugins page, tab Installed, see Managing plugins for details. Make sure you have Node.js on your computer. See Node.js with Docker, Node.js via SSH, and Node.js with Vagrant for details. To run a Node.js application remotely, configure it as a remote interpreter. In most cases, WebStorm detects Node.js installations, configures them as interpreters automatically, and adds them to the list where you can select the relevant one. If you want to switch among several Node.js installations, they must be configured as local Node.js interpreters. If you follow the standard installation procedure, in most cases WebStorm detects Node.js itself.Īnd even if you have no Node.js on your computer, you can install it when creating a new Node.js application in the Create New Project dialog, see Creating a new Node.js application below. If you need Node.js only as a local runtime for your application or for managing npm packages, running JavaScript linters, build tools, test frameworks, and so on, just install Node.js. WebStorm integrates with Node.js providing assistance in configuring, editing, running, debugging, testing, profiling, and maintaining your applications. is a lightweight runtime environment for executing JavaScript outside the browser, for example on the server or in the command line. ✔ Would you like to install them now with npm? Īt this moment, your project has a new file. Then the initializer will check any peer dependencies. ✔ What format do you want your config file to be in? ✔ Which style guide do you want to follow? ✔ How would you like to define a style for your project? ✔ Which framework does your project use? ✔ What type of modules does your project use? eslint -initĪnd you must confirm any parameters such as (use your own choices): Your typescript project looks good, but is not working yet, in this step you must configure the eslint tool. skipLibCheck: true (Skip type checking all.strict: true (Enable all strict type-checking options).forceConsistenCasingInFileNames: true (Ensure that casing is correct in imports).This enables 'allowSyntheticDefaultImports' for type compatibility) esModuleInterop: true (Emit additional JavaScript to ease support for importing CommonJS modules.dist (Specify an output folder for all emitted files) sourceMap: true (Create source map files for emitted JavaScript files).moduleResolution: node (Specify how TypeScript looks up a file from a given module specifier).dev (or src, Specify the root folder within your source files) module: commonjs (Specify what module code is generated).target: es2017 (Set the JavaScript language version for emitted JavaScript and include compatible library declarations.).It's highly recommended that your tsconfig.json file includes almost these directives in compiler Options: To end this step, you must create the directories and your initial TS file. Before continuing with your setup, you must create the TypeScript project initialing it to make their tsconfig.json file:īefore contiuing, you need to have a clear basic structure for your project as: You must create a new project with a Node.js setup.Įnsure that you are using the right Node Interpreter and Package Manager (npm, yarn, pnpm)Īt this moment, you have a new Node.js empty project. The next steps are required to start a new TypeScript project. Let's confirm on the application preferences the use of your TS version. You must have installed TypeScript from your favorite package manager (npm, yarn, pnpm). Ensure that you have the JavaScript and TypeScript plugin installed (Preferences | Plugins).The first time you must follow steps one and two, also when you reinstall your IDE. But don't worry, setting up a TS project is really easy: It includes almost all features desired by developers, a large community is in the background, and a great company is behind the lines.īy default doesn't exist a TypeScript project template in IntelliJ IDEA. IntelliJ IDEA is a powerful Integrated Development Environment IDE developed by JetBrains for the most rigorous development environments.
0 Comments
Leave a Reply.A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|